Maui Walk Against Domestic Violence Steps into 4th Year
By Maui Now Staff
Women Helping Women and the West Maui Domestic Violence Task Force invite the public to participate in the 4th Annual Walk A Mile in Her Shoes event on Saturday, Oct. 3, from 10 a.m. to 12 p.m. at Whaler’s Village in Kāʻanapali.
During the event, volunteers and community leaders take a pledge to help end domestic violence by participating in a walk to raise awareness for the cause.
In past years, organizers encouraged men to be leaders in the ongoing effort to prevent violence against women by asking them to walk a “mile” in women’s high-heeled shoes.
Participants will have a chance to win prizes and special awards for the best costume, largest team and most walker sponsorships. Walkers can register and put a team together at the event website. Donations are welcome as well.
This year the walk with be located oceanfront with registration set to start at 9:30 a.m.
